WebDec 9, 2024 · A load cell is a transducer that converts the mechanical force into readable electrical units, similar to our regular weighing scales. Their main purpose is to weigh or … WebShear beam load cells are widely used where operators need to measure compressive forces. The core component of a shear beam load cell is a spring element. This element is a piece of metal that is elastically deformed under load and recovers the moment the load is …

A load cell’s basic function is to take applied force and convert it into an output signal that provides the user with a measurement. This process of converting a force into data is typically completed through a Wheatstone bridge that is comprised of strain gages. There …
